What to Look for in a Kitchen Faucet Pull Out Spray

Spray head material and construction

Prioritize a spray head crafted from solid brass. This metal offers superior durability, resisting corrosion and physical damage far better than plastic alternatives. Look for finishes like polished chrome or brushed nickel for classic appeal and resistance to water spots, while matte black provides a modern statement.

Read More  Best Beef Stew Pressure Cooker: Top 10 Picks

A weighted spray head indicates quality construction, contributing to a satisfying heft and control during use. Ensure the nozzles are designed for easy cleaning; silicone or rubberized nubs prevent mineral buildup, guaranteeing a consistent spray pattern.

For consistent performance and longevity, choose solid brass construction with easy-clean nozzles.

Integration and hose design

The ideal hose design balances reach with seamless retraction. Aim for a hose length of at least 20 inches to comfortably reach all corners of your sink basin and beyond. Braided stainless steel hoses offer exceptional durability and kink resistance, superior to standard polymer hoses that can become brittle over time.

A smooth, reliable retraction mechanism is crucial; test this by gently pulling and releasing the spray head. Look for secure, simple connection fittings that require no specialized tools, simplifying installation significantly.

For dependable operation and extended reach, select a braided stainless steel hose of 20 inches or more.

Spray functionality and control

Seek out faucets offering at least two distinct spray functions: a standard aerated stream for everyday tasks and a powerful spray for rinsing dishes. The spray-setting button should be intuitively placed and easy to press with a wet hand, allowing for quick transitions. A flow rate of 1.8 gallons per minute (GPM) is standard and efficient for most uses, while higher rates are available but less water-conscious.

A dedicated pause button is invaluable for temporarily halting water flow without touching the handles, preventing splashes and conserving water. Opt for a pull-out faucet with at least two spray settings, an easy-to-use button, and a pause function for optimal usability.

Frequently Asked Questions

What Is The Most Durable Material For A Kitchen Faucet Pull Out Spray Head?

Solid brass construction is generally the most durable material for a kitchen faucet pull out spray head. This robust metal resists corrosion and wear from constant use and water exposure, ensuring longevity and a premium feel over time.

How Does Hose Length Impact The Usability Of A Pull Out Spray Faucet?

Hose length significantly impacts a pull out spray faucet’s usability by determining its reach. A longer hose allows you to easily fill pots and pans on the counter, clean the entire sink basin, and even manage tasks for pets without strain.

What Are The Benefits Of Multiple Spray Settings On A Pull Out Faucet?

Multiple spray settings offer superior versatility for various kitchen tasks. An aerated stream is ideal for filling and general use, while a powerful spray effectively rinses dishes and cleans the sink, making your daily chores more efficient.

Why Is A Smooth Retraction Mechanism Important For Pull Out Spray Faucets?

A smooth retraction mechanism ensures the longevity and convenience of your pull out spray faucet. It prevents hose kinking and snagging, which can lead to wear and tear, and guarantees the spray head returns neatly to its docked position after each use.

Are Easy-Clean Spray Nozzles Essential For A Kitchen Faucet Pull Out Spray?

Yes, easy-clean spray nozzles are highly beneficial for any kitchen faucet pull out spray. Features like silicone or rubberized nubs allow you to effortlessly wipe away mineral deposits and hard water buildup, maintaining optimal water flow and hygiene.
